    Foreign Income Tax under L1 Visa with no substantial presence test
    I have an L1 Visa for more than 3 years, but stays in the US for less than 3 months a year.
    I pay US taxes on my US Income.

    I also trade US stocks while I am abroad. Do I have to pay Income Tax on Stock Gains, or can I claim Foreign Status.

    Luis
  • Oct 25, 2007, 09:18 AM
    AtlantaTaxExpert
    Luis:

    You can claim foreign status and NOT pay capital gain taxes on your stock transactions.
